New complexes of the type R3PAuL or (R3PAu)2(mu-L) where R=ethyl or phenyl and L=6-thioguanine, 2,6-dithioxanthine, 2,4-dithiouracil and/or dithioerythritol have been prepared. These complexes have been identified by using elemental analysis, H-1, C-13 and P-31 NMR spectroscopy. The structures have been proposed based on these spectroscopic studies. Sulfur appears to be the binding site in disubstituted complexes of 2,4-dithiouracil and 1,4-dithioerythritol, while the phosphine gold(I) moieties appear to be S and N bonded in 2,6-dithioxanthine and 6-thioguanine. The potential use of these complexes as antitumor drugs is discussed.
